Today I made Chocolate Babka which a twisted bread filled with chocolate and/or cinnamon - popular in Jewish culture. I had two recipes to choose from (my new book or Cooking Light) and I went with the light version. Here is the recipe. I struggled a bit with this one since the recipe calls for using a stand mixer (which I don't have here) and bread flour. Bread flour doesn't quite translate - I ended up with a type of bread flour but it was a lot grainer then the US type so this had more of a bite to it then I expected but it was yummy! Even with my complications I was pleased with the result.
